A flurry of Ramya films in the offing

Aug 19, 2006 R.G. Vijayasarathy



Bangalore, Aug 19 (IANS) After her two recent hits, "Datta" and "Sevanthi Sevanthi", Kannada actress Ramya is going places.


She has signed three films - "Arasu", "Jote Joteyalli" and "Thananam Thananam" - and trade pundits feel that all of them will strike gold at the box office.


The first one to go on floors is "Arasu", to be directed by Mahesh Babu who plans to begin shooting next month. He has also roped in Meera Jasmine as the second heroine.


This will be Ramya's third film with Puneet Raj Kumar after silver-jubilee hits "Akash" and "Abhi".


Her second venture is matinee idol Darshan's "Jote Joteyalli", to be directed by his brother Divakar. In this film, Ramya's co-star will be Prem, whose last film "Nenapirali" was a big success. Apart from them, it will also have Darshan in a guest role.


But Ramya is thrilled about "Thananam Thananam" which is being made by award-winning director Kavitha Lankesh.


At the moment, the actress is shooting in London for an untitled Tamil film with Shaam as the hero.
